DIRECTOR OF FINANCIAL SYSTEMS

The Director of Financial Systems leads the strategy, architecture, and integration roadmaps for Scentbird's financial technology ecosystem, with a primary focus on NetSuite as our core ERP platform. This senior leadership role drives high-impact improvements in financial operations efficiency, data integrity, automation, and scalability to support rapid business growth in our subscription-based e-commerce model. The position ensures robust governance, compliance, and risk management across financial systems while enabling seamless integrations with other business applications. Reporting directly to the CTO, this role sits within the Technology/Finance department and collaborates closely with Finance, Accounting, IT, and cross-functional teams to align systems with strategic business objectives.

What You’ll Be Responsible For:

  • Define and execute the long-term strategy, architecture, and integration roadmaps for financial systems, prioritizing NetSuite enhancements to support evolving business needs
  • Oversee NetSuite governance, including role-based access controls, segregation of duties, audit trails, change management, and compliance with regulatory requirements (e.g., SOX readiness, data privacy standards)
  • Lead the financial systems team in system configuration, upgrades, customizations, troubleshooting, and ongoing optimization to ensure reliability, performance, and security
  • Manage integrations between NetSuite and other platforms (e.g., e-commerce, CRM, payment gateways, inventory, analytics tools) to enable end-to-end process automation and real-time data flow
  • Establish and enforce internal controls, data integrity standards, security protocols, and monitoring processes to mitigate risks and support audit readiness
  • Collaborate with Finance leadership on financial reporting, process automation, and analytics initiatives using NetSuite tools like SuiteAnalytics, Saved Searches, and SuiteScripts
  • Drive continuous improvement by identifying opportunities for automation, process re-engineering, and technology adoption to reduce manual effort and enhance accuracy
  • Provide strategic guidance on financial systems projects, vendor management, budgeting for system initiatives, and cross-functional stakeholder alignment

What You’ll Need to Have:

  • 10+ years of progressive experience in financial IT, ERP systems implementation, administration, and governance, with significant hands-on expertise in enterprise financial platforms
  • Proven expertise in NetSuite (Oracle NetSuite), including administration, configuration, customization (SuiteBuilder, SuiteFlow, SuiteScript), integrations (SuiteTalk, REST APIs), and governance/compliance best practices
  • Relevant certifications such as NetSuite Administrator, NetSuite ERP Consultant, CISSP, CISA, or equivalent security/compliance credentials
  • Strong understanding of financial processes (order-to-cash, procure-to-pay, financial close, reporting) in a subscription or e-commerce environment
  • Demonstrated experience leading teams, managing complex projects, and driving ERP/system transformations in mid-to-large organizations
  • Deep knowledge of internal controls, risk management, audit trails, segregation of duties, and compliance frameworks (e.g., SOX, GDPR considerations)
  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Information Systems, Computer Science, or related field; MBA or advanced degree preferred
  • Excellent analytical, technical, and communication skills with proficiency in tools like SQL, BI/reporting platforms, and integration technologies
